Cement Cement Extraction and processing: Raw materials employed in the manufacture of cement are extracted by quarrying in the case of hard rocks such as limestones, slates, and some shales, with the aid of blasting when necessary. Some deposits are mined by underground methods. Softer rocks such as chalk and clay can be dug directly by excavators.

The pervious concrete is created by unique mixing process, performance, appliion methods etc. These are used in the construction of pavements and driveways where storm water issues persist. The storm water will pass through these pervious concrete pavements and reach the groundwater. Hence most of the drainage issues is solved. 16. Carbon dioxide (CO2) is a by. product of a chemical conversion process used in the production of clinker, a component of cement, in which. CO2 emissions. limestone (CaCO3) is converted to lime (CaO). CO2 is also emitted during cement production by fossil fuel.

Concrete manufacturers expect their raw material suppliers to supply a consistent, uniform product. At the cement production factory, the proportions of the various raw materials that go into cement must be checked to achieve a consistent kiln feed, and samples of the mix are frequently examined using Xray fluorescence analysis.

· Threequarters of cement production since 1990 occurred in China, which used more cement between 2011 and 2013 than the US did in the entire 20th century. Cement production and emissions from 2010 to 2015. Source: Analysis of Olivier et al. (2016) by Chatham House. 19/03/2017 · Fresh concrete is that stage of concrete in which concrete can be moulded and it is in plastic state. This is also called "Green Concrete". Another term used to describe the state of fresh concrete is consistence, which is the ease with which concrete will flow. The production of cement is a twostep process that involves producing a clinker from raw materials (mainly limestone and clay) that is heated within a kiln at an intense heat, before being cooled at 100 o C – 200 o C. In a second step, gypsum and sometimes additions like coal fly ash are added to the clinker and ground to a fine cement powder.
Portland cement gets its strength from chemical reactions between the cement and water. The process is known as hydration.
